There's a difference between 1.10 and 1.11 that I don't understand.
Performing a "cvs co -c" using 1.10 correctly provides a listing of the
projects. The version shows "Concurrent Versions System (CVS) 1.10
`Halibut' (client)".
Performing a "cvs co -c" using 1.11.6 just says ": no such repository".
The version shows "Concurrent Versions System (CVS) 1.11.6
(client/server)".
CVSROOT is :pserver:SOMEUSER@SOMEHOST:/export/cvsroot and matches
CVS/Root.
